ChatGPT, powered by OpenAI’s GPT‑4, is a widely adopted language model that can be used as a lead‑generation chatbot for bakeries through its API. The model excels at natural language understanding and generation, making it ideal for answering visitor questions about recipes, ingredient substitutions, and order status. By combining the model with a simple web widget and custom prompts, bakeries can create a conversational bot that guides users toward purchases or newsletter sign‑ups. While ChatGPT itself does not offer a visual editor or built‑in e‑commerce integration, developers can leverage third‑party services or custom code to connect the bot to Shopify or WooCommerce. The API supports prompt engineering, allowing businesses to tailor the bot’s tone and response style. Additionally, the model can store context within a single conversation, but it does not provide persistent long‑term memory across sessions without additional backend logic. Pricing for the API is based on token usage: $0.0015 per 1 000 prompt tokens and $0.002 per 1 000 completion tokens. A ChatGPT Plus subscription costs $20/month for the web interface.

Google Dialogflow is a popular natural language understanding platform that enables developers to create conversational agents for a variety of channels, including web chat. It offers a visual flow builder and supports integration with Google Cloud services, making it suitable for bakeries that already use the Google ecosystem. Dialogflow’s key strengths include intent recognition, entity extraction, and fulfillment via webhook, allowing the bot to retrieve product information from a Shopify backend or a custom inventory API. The platform also supports multi‑language support, which can be useful for bakeries serving diverse clientele. However, Dialogflow requires a developer to set up and maintain the webhook endpoints and to embed the chat widget manually. Pricing is tiered: the Standard Edition is free for up to 1 000 text requests per month; the Premium Edition charges $0.004 per text request. Audio requests cost $0.006 per request in both editions.

Microsoft Power Virtual Agents provides a no‑code chatbot builder that integrates seamlessly with the Power Platform and Azure services. Bakers can use the drag‑and‑drop authoring canvas to create conversational flows that answer product questions, guide visitors through ordering, and collect lead information. The platform’s strengths include integration with Dynamics 365 for customer data, Power Automate for workflow automation, and Azure Cognitive Services for additional AI capabilities. Power Virtual Agents can be embedded on a website via a simple script, and the bot can call Azure Functions to fetch inventory data from a Shopify store. However, the platform does not have a dedicated visual editor for the chat widget’s appearance; styling is limited to predefined themes. Pricing is based on the number of sessions: a base license costs $1,000 per year for up to 1 000 sessions, with additional sessions priced at $1 per session. Microsoft offers a free trial.
